About Writing Organization Interactive Worksheets
On Education.com, writing organization interactive worksheets help students learn to structure and organize their writing. These materials include prompts, graphic organizers, and practice exercises that guide students through planning, drafting, and revising essays, stories, and reports. Educators and parents can use these resources to reinforce writing skills and support creative expression in an engaging way.
Materials on Education.com provide various formats, such as printable worksheets, digital exercises, and interactive activities that teach students to arrange ideas logically and use writing conventions effectively. These resources adapt to different grade levels and learning styles, making writing practice accessible and enjoyable. By using structured worksheets and exercises, students develop confidence in expressing their thoughts clearly.
